Loss of Relationship Trust: Pornography addiction can lead to dishonesty and deception about its use, which can decrease the amount of trust and satisfaction in a relationship.They will likely also spend less time with their partner, and the time spent together may seem less enjoyable because the person with an addiction is distracted by thoughts of porn. Lack of Emotional Closeness: Porn addiction can lead to a lack of emotional closeness as the person may become more focused on their addiction than on building intimacy and connection with their partner.Feelings of Betrayal From Partner: Porn addiction can lead to feelings of betrayal from a relationship partner, as they may feel that their partner’s use of pornography and masturbation is a form of infidelity or cheating.When their partner cannot meet these impossible expectations or feels uncomfortable with them, the person with an addiction may become sexually dissatisfied. Sexual Dissatisfaction With Partner: People addicted to porn may compare their real-life partners to those they see in porn and hold them to unrealistic expectations or standards.These problems can lead to serious negative consequences in relationships and a person’s sex life that can be difficult to repair. Porn addiction can lead to decreased intimacy, communication, trust in relationships, and feelings of shame and isolation. Over time, isolation from porn use can worsen mental health and exacerbate addiction, creating a cycle that is difficult to break. People with a porn addiction may also feel shame and guilt, leading to social withdrawal and avoidance of social situations. Porn addiction can lead to isolation, as viewing pornography can consume most of a person’s time and energy, leaving little room for socializing and building meaningful relationships.
